Details:
The bright auroras lasted for half an hour around midnight ET (easy to see them and also distinguish the red hue) and then the auroras continue but not as bright. The SAR arc was noticeable before the auroras and lasted at least until 3:30 am ET. It was very nice seeing the arc going through Orion rising. Both images have minimal processing. Taken with Canon T3i and 16mm lens. Aperture is f/11 for the Aurora (I didn't realize about the wrong aperture setting until after taking this image) and f/4 for the SAR arc.
